<span>f(x+5/4) means that f(x) is translated 5/4 units left.
f(x-5/4) means that f(x) is translated 5/4 units right.
f(x)-5/4 means that f(x) is translated 5/4 units down.
f(x)+5/4 means that f(x) is translated 5/4 units up.
f(x*5/4) means that f(x) is compressed by a factor of 5/4.
f(x/5/4) means that f(x) is stretched by a factor of 5/4.</span>
